Expanded 1902, about twice the length of 1893 collection The Celtic Twilight: Men and Women, Dhouls and Faeries (see).
"a miscellany of tales, Fables and sketches showing the relationship between humankind and the Fairies" (underscore represents linked cross-reference) --SFE: Encyclopedia of Fantasy (1997), biographical entry by Mike Ashley
